The work
A custom residence on this coast is governed by its site before it is governed by its architecture. Wind exposure, flood elevation, soil conditions, and the Coastal Construction Control Line set the design criteria before the first framing decision gets made. Two lots on the same street can carry different requirements.
We work the foundation question first, because it drives cost more than anything else on the drawing set. Depending on the soil report and the flood zone, that can mean shallow footings, deep foundations, or an elevated pile-supported structure with breakaway construction below the design flood elevation.
From there the structural system follows the architecture. Long spans over glass, cantilevered decks, roof geometry, and the load path from those elements down to the foundation get resolved with the architect while the design is still changing cheaply.
Where the site needs it, our civil staff carry grading, drainage, and stormwater alongside the structure, and permitting runs through the county and the water management district with jurisdiction. The same firm and the same project manager carry the structural and civil drawings.
